Good News! How to get a Desktop Charger.

Regarding the Desktop Charger for the Casio G'zOne Commando phone (part# : VZW771DTC):

I've seen a lot of people stating Verizon is always out of stock. I was one of them. Fortunately, this isn't really the case. It's a problem (possibly by design) with their website. They actually have them in stock around the country, but not in every region.

If you change your location you can easily find a location in a region that has them in stock. For example, Los Angeles, California. I've experimented with this and when I'm using a mid-west location, they are out of stock. When I use a west coast location, they are in stock. If I then change back to a mid-west location they are out of stock again.

For those who don't know where the location is, look at the very top line on the VerizonWireless web page. Your location will be left of the "Store Locator" and "Espaniol" language option. Just click on your location and you will have the option to change it either by zip code or by state and then city.
I ordered mine yesterday doing this and they just shipped out from Ontario, California.

This probably works for ANY out of stock item on their site.

Hope this helps a few people get their desktop chargers.
Remember, if you're getting more than one, that they don't come with a wall plug-in so you'll need to get an extra wall charger too.

Has anyone else noticed that the phone doesn't seem to fully charge in the cradle?

When I put my commando in the cradle, the charging light comes on. In the morning, the charge light is still on and my battery widget shows 99%. If I put it back on the cradle for a few seconds, it changes to 100%. When I plug it in directly to the charger without the cradle, it fully charges in just a few hours.
